The MRC, or Mountain Radio Challenge,
started around 1980. The idea was to see what distance could be achieved, on 27MHz, using ground wave. Anyone could talk skip interstate or overseas, but to talk long distance without skip was a challenge. Originating from CBers in the North Eastern Suburbs of Melbourne, they would find mountains to camp on for the night, and see what distances that could be achieved.
